Education & Requirements

Minimum two (2) years of actuarial experience
Healthcare and/or Medicaid experience is preferred
Bachelor’s degree from an accredited institution required
Passed three (3) SOA exams - pursuing the designation of ASA (Associate) in the Society of Actuaries
